We are looking for an Engineering Manager to join our IaaS Engineering organization at DigitalOcean. You will lead a team of talented software engineers as you help engineer and operationalize development productivity tools including GHE, CI/CD tooling, Artifactory and others to enable our developers to build and release products in an efficient and painless manner. You will be hands-on architecting, delivering and operating critical tools and continually measuring productivity and adoption of platform services delivered to internal customers at DO. This position works with technology managers to improve the software engineering processes and practices associated with continuously building, deploying, and updating software and environments.
What You’ll Be Doing:
- Manages and drives end-to-end process design, improvements, automation and management of the release engineering practice.
- Provides analysis to inform and educate tactical and strategic need for new telemetry and tooling
- Manages and continuously improves our CI/CD pipeline and process to increase automation and adoption.
- Maintains relationships and coordinate work between different development teams at DigitalOcean
- Engages with Technical Project Manager, Tech Lead and relevant stakeholders/teams to ensure specifications for services, tools and process requirements are met
- Ensures the Infrastructure/Application and system design at project/ program level meets architectural standards
- Informs build vs buy decisions for tools and services
- Demonstrates technical leadership while promoting professional development for engineering staff through timely feedback and coaching
